Herding would be a great idea, because he will be taught to obey your signals/commands...which include STOP! and WATCH! He will learn it's OK to "herd" when called upon, but it's NOT OK to simply chase anything that runs.
Long line boot camp is a great idea, as well. I would consider doing both. The long line will give you the needed "let's nip this behavior in the bud" for now. The herding classes will give him an appropriate outlet. He can actualize, APPROPRIATELY, what was bred into them many years ago.
